Transaction 3085250e1563fb4eb0410945376e0eb2da2db12a4451122f64bad48dbcc3dc9c
1 Input
2 Outputs
- 3085250e1563fb4eb0410945376e0eb2da2db12a4451122f64bad48dbcc3dc9c:0
- 3085250e1563fb4eb0410945376e0eb2da2db12a4451122f64bad48dbcc3dc9c:1
value 17687670
address 3ASuGuVza1yctDKn4cXtW2z2iLfGQHAJxR
value 891219344
address 38yk2oFSGbFXtJy1phekajYya2XnQuFmKt